What is a Concrete Calculator?

The Concrete Calculator estimates the volume and weight of concrete necessary to cover a given area. Purchasing slightly more concrete than the estimated result can reduce the probability of having insufficient concrete.

How Concrete Volume is Calculated

  • For Slabs, Footings & Walls: Length × Width × Thickness
  • For Columns & Round Footings: π × (Diameter/2)² × Height
  • For Circular Slabs & Tubes: π × [(Outer Diameter/2)² – (Inner Diameter/2)²] × Height
  • For Curb & Gutter: Combined cross-sectional area × Length
  • For Stairs: Sum of individual step volumes plus platform volume

Understanding Concrete Materials

Concrete is a composite material consisting of fine and coarse aggregate bonded with a fluid cement that hardens over time. The most common form of concrete is Portland cement concrete, which consists of mineral aggregate (generally gravel and sand), Portland cement and water.

Tips for Concrete Projects

  • Always add a waste factor of 5-10% to your calculations
  • For large projects, consider ordering slightly more than calculated
  • Standard concrete mix has a density of approximately 150 lb/ft³ (2,400 kg/m³)
  • One cubic yard of concrete weighs about 4,050 pounds (2 tons)
  • Allow adequate curing time (typically 28 days for full strength)

Common Concrete Mix Ratios

Strength Cement Sand Gravel
High (4000+ psi) 1 2 3
Medium (3000 psi) 1 2.5 3.5
Low (2000 psi) 1 3 4
